An Ebola outbreak in the Democratic Republic of Congo has claimed the lives of at least people and another six are suspected to be infected with the virus. This is according to the World Health Organisation which has reported that health officials are travelling to the central African country in response to a rising number of suspected cases of the deadly virus.
